Sorry if this is an old subject, but i searched high and low for an answer and could not find one !! I am running 767pic with FS2000, sqwakbox and roger wilco. I am aslo using the latest FSUIPC version2.972....My problem is every time I try and interecpt the ILS for 06 at EHAM my fuel goes to zero, engines stop and power goes off, followed by a stall..This may happen at other airports, but EHAM is the only one so far..Any ideas would be greatfully apprecaited.... Hi,This information is from the Website of DutchVacc:"Pilots running Squawkbox, experience heavy windshears when passing through 2500ft when they approach or depart from Amsterdam Schiphol in south- and southwestern directions. All engines fall out and the aircraft is suddenly uncontrollable. This is caused by the fact that Schiphol is located below sea level and SB doesn't handle those values correctly. To solve this problem, change the option WindTransitions, found in the General section of FSUIPC.ini (in the modules directory of FS2002) from No to Yes." Kind Regards,Nicowww.nicokaan.nl
